Dimonoff provides IoT-based solutions for smart cities, focusing on remote management of connected assets for municipalities, utilities, and infrastructure managers. Its offerings include wireless smart nodes, connected sensors, and cloud-based asset management platforms that monitor and control urban assets. The company also develops custom IoT hardware and software—covering wireless, cloud, embedded systems, and Linux—to tailor products for specific infrastructure needs. Unlike competitors who offer generic hardware or software, Dimonoff emphasizes end-to-end, customized solutions plus integration and long-term maintenance, enabling scalable monitoring and control of urban systems. The goal is to strengthen the sustainability and safety of urban infrastructures by enabling accurate environmental monitoring, asset visibility, and proactive management through IoT networks.

Empowering smarter cities with the SCMS platform. Dimonoff's Smart City Management System (SCMS) serves as a powerful backbone for connected urban infrastructure. Designed to centralize asset management, SCMS enables cities to monitor, control, and optimize public infrastructure in real time. A flagship example is Dimonoff's large-scale smart lighting project with the City of Pittsburgh, where more than 36,500 LED streetlights are managed through the SCMS platform. This initiative enhances energy efficiency, improves maintenance operations through proactive monitoring, and supports sustainability objectives while laying out the foundation for future smart city applications. Another strong example of SCMS in action is the City of Laval, QC, where Dimonoff deployed a centralized smart city management platform to support both smart street lighting and dynamic signage panels. By managing thousands of connected assets through a single interface, Laval has improved operational efficiency, reduced energy consumption, and built a scalable foundation for future smart city initiatives, demonstrating how SCMS can evolve beyond lighting to support broader urban infrastructure needs. Smarter parking experiences with the Spatium platform. In addition to smart city infrastructure, Dimonoff will also highlight Spatium, its centralized IoT parking management platform. Spatium unifies parking operations, such as occupancy monitoring, access control, payment systems, and dynamic guidance, into a single, intuitive interface. A recent deployment at Royalmount, a major mixed-use development, demonstrates how Spatium simplifies parking operations across 4,000 parking spaces, improves real-time visibility, and enhances the driver experience through smart guidance and analytics-driven decision-making. About Dimonoff. Since 2006, Dimonoff has been at the forefront of IoT-based smart city solutions, specializing in smart lighting management, connected asset control, and parking management systems. With a track record of over 575 projects across 6 countries and more than 850,000 products deployed, Dimonoff delivers innovative, scalable solutions that enhance the efficiency, sustainability, and livability of cities. Its smart technology manages hundreds of thousands of streetlights in cities across North America, and Dimonoff inc. work closely with both public and private sector leaders to ensure seamless implementation and long-term success of its solutions.
Dimonoff received a $6 million investment from Fundamental and BDC to expand its intelligent management platform for cities and enter international markets. Dimonoff acquired Amotus in 2018 unified both entities in 2021 to combine the brand image and standardize its service offering under the Dimonoff brand.
